Not known Factual Statements About online battle royale shooting games
activity is due to launch in January 2023 and is also currently being produced by Motive Studios. The science-fiction horror survival match will likely be set while in the twenty sixth century and observe engineer Isaac Clarke. Gamers ought to do the job to outlive and fend off an intense alien invasion. Lifeless Space 1 and a couple ofCounter-Stri